Résumé

In "Scientific Method in Biology, " Elizabeth Blackwell presents a comprehensive exploration of the methodologies that underpin biological inquiry. This text delineates the essential principles of the scientific method as applied to biological research, emphasizing empirical observation, hypothesis formulation, and experimental validation. Blackwell's literary style is both accessible and authoritative, catering to a diverse readership, including students and seasoned scientists alike.
The book navigates the historical evolution of biological sciences, providing context for contemporary practices and innovations, while underscoring the significance of a rigorous scientific approach in understanding complex life systems. Elizabeth Blackwell, a pioneering figure in both medicine and biology, has laid the groundwork for many advancements through her advocacy for scientific education and research.
Her own experiences as a medical practitioner in an era dominated by male counterparts likely informed her dedication to elucidating the scientific method. By synthesizing her extensive knowledge and practical insights, Blackwell interweaves personal narrative with rigorous academic discourse, enriching the reader's experience.
